Hi James,

>>
>> Where is the agent documentation?
> 
> I wanted to get your preference, I can add a separate agent API specifically for 
> shared code (RequestSharedCode), or we can piggy back off (since its the same 
> signature):

My first reaction is to use a separate agent, similarly to how we handled 
SignalLevelAgent.

> 
> RequestUserPassword(object network, string user)

APIs should be self-documenting as much as possible, so I think re-using the 
method falls short of that goal in this case.
